OK, making some progress here. I erase-then-copy to my external backup disk, which I gather puts an OS on it. Then I smart update to that disk. Now, when I Power-Boot, I am offered that external backup disk as a boot option. I choose that option and ... it boots to my internal disk. Duh? I can tell that because I put a file on my internal disk desktop, and it appears, and also that SysPrefs->StartupDisk shows only my internal disk, which I presume is confirming that that's the disk I'm booted to.

So I guess I succeeded in making a bootable backup, but I can't get my machine to boot to it!
